See how to use percent formulas to calculate percentages and find unknowns in percent equations.</description><pubDate>Sun, 31 May 2026 08:53:00 GMT</pubDate></item><item><title>The Percent Calculator</title><link>https://thepercentcalculator.com/</link><description>When a value is expressed as a percentage, it represents how much of the whole or total amount it represents out of 100. For example: 25 percent, written 25% = 25/100, it means 25 out of 100, or One of four equal parts (1/4, ¼, 0.25).</description><pubDate>Sun, 31 May 2026 16:24:00 GMT</pubDate></item><item><title>Percentage Calculator ％ - Percent Change &amp; Percent Difference Calculator</title><link>https://www.gigacalculator.com/calculators/percentage-calculator.php</link><description>A versatile percent calculator.
